Shakespeare’s Fool

The Old Courts Crawford Street, Wigan, United Kingdom

Will ‘Cavaliero’ Kempe was one of the finest performers of the Elizabethan age. Gentleman player, juggling jester, headmaster of Morris dancers and London’s finest clown, until…he fell out with Will ‘git face’ Shakespeare. Kempe died alone and poverty stricken, not very far from the original Globe Theatre, of which he was an original shareholder and faded into obscurity. The Bluebird

The Old Courts Crawford Street, Wigan, United Kingdom

Inspired by Maeterlinck’s Bluebird, this show raises important philosophical questions for children & adults within a compelling, interactive quest adventure. What is the bluebird and where could it be hiding? In the Land of Memory, the Future, the Land of Luxury, or has it flown to the Land of Night? Or have we simply lost the ability to see or hear it? The audience need to discover their own answers helped by plenty of theatrical magic.
